Consider the sequence 100, 95, 90, 85, 80, 75 ...<br> What is the value of f(8)?
MAVERICK [17]

Answer:

f(8) = 65

Step-by-step explanation:

Find a pattern in the sequence. It might be an <u>arithmetic sequence</u> (always adds or subtract by a certain number), or a <u>geometric sequence</u> (always multiplies or divides by a certain number).

To find a pattern in this decreasing sequence, we find either the common difference or the common divisor of each pair of consecutive numbers.

• 100 - 95 = 5

• 95 - 90 = 5

• 90 - 85 = 5

• 85 - 80 = 5

• 80 - 75 = 5

Now, we know that this is an <u>arithmetic sequence</u>, and the common difference is <u>5</u>.

To calculate f(8), we find the 8th term in the sequence. We can do that by counting the terms in the sequence and using the common difference, 5, that we found, to continue the sequence.

• f(1) = 100

• f(2) = 95

• f(3) = 90

     ......

• f(7) = 70

• f(8) = 65

Are 12x^2y^3z and -45zy^3x2 like terms? explain why or why not.
Alex787 [66]

Here in the second term I am considering 2 as power of x .

So rewriting both the terms here:

First term: 12x²y³z

Second term: -45zy³x²

Let us now find out whether they are like terms or not.

"Like terms" are terms whose variables (and their exponents such as the 2 in x²) are the same.

In the given two terms let us find exponents of each variable and compare them for both terms.

z : first and second term both have exponent 1

x: first and second term both have exponent 2

y: first and second term both have exponent 3

Since we have all the exponents equal for both first and second terms variables, so we can say that the two terms are like terms.
